WHAT IS HOME INSURANCE IN AUSTRALIA?
Home insurance is a type of financial protection that covers damage or loss related to residential properties. It generally includes two main components:
- Building insurance (structure of the home)
- Contents insurance (personal belongings inside the home)
Some policies combine both types into a single package, while others allow customers to choose separately depending on their needs.
Home insurance is not legally required in Australia, but it is strongly recommended and often required by banks when taking a mortgage.
BUILDING INSURANCE
Building insurance covers the physical structure of the home. This includes the walls, roof, floors, windows, and permanent fixtures such as kitchens and bathrooms.
It typically protects against:
- Fire and bushfire damage
- Storms and cyclones
- Flood damage (depending on policy)
- Earthquakes and natural disasters
- Vandalism and malicious damage
- Burst pipes and water damage
If a home is severely damaged or destroyed, building insurance helps cover repair or rebuilding costs.
CONTENTS INSURANCE
Contents insurance covers personal belongings inside the home. This includes items that are not permanently attached to the property.
Commonly covered items include:
- Furniture
- Electronics such as TVs and computers
- Clothing and personal items
- Kitchen appliances
- Jewelry and valuables (with limits)
Contents insurance is especially important for renters, as it protects their belongings even though they do not own the building.

WHAT IS NOT COVERED?
It is important to understand exclusions in home insurance policies. Common exclusions include:
- General wear and tear
- Poor maintenance or neglect
- Damage caused intentionally by the owner
- Certain types of flood damage (depending on policy)
- Pest infestations such as termites
- Illegal construction or modifications
Reading policy details carefully is important to avoid unexpected surprises during claims.
COST OF HOME INSURANCE IN AUSTRALIA
The cost of home insurance varies widely depending on several factors. Insurance providers assess risk before calculating premiums.
Key factors affecting cost include:
- Location of the property
- Risk of natural disasters in the area
- Value of the home and contents
- Type of construction materials
- Security features (alarms, cameras, locks)
- Claim history of the owner
- Level of coverage chosen
Homes in high-risk areas such as flood zones or bushfire-prone regions usually have higher premiums.
HOME INSURANCE FOR RENTERS
Renters in Australia do not need building insurance, but they are strongly encouraged to get contents insurance. This protects their personal belongings from theft, fire, and damage.
Renters insurance typically covers:
- Personal possessions
- Temporary accommodation costs
- Liability for accidental damage to the property
- Theft from the rented home
It provides financial security for tenants who want to protect their valuables.
LANDLORD INSURANCE
Landlord insurance is designed for property owners who rent out their homes. It provides protection beyond standard home insurance.
It usually includes:
- Damage caused by tenants
- Loss of rental income
- Theft or vandalism by tenants
- Legal liability protection
- Building and contents cover (if furnished rental)
This type of insurance is important for real estate investors.

CLAIMS PROCESS
The claims process in Australia is generally straightforward but requires proper documentation.
Typical steps include:
- Reporting the incident to the insurer
- Providing evidence such as photos and receipts
- Assessment by an insurance adjuster
- Approval or rejection of the claim
- Repair, replacement, or compensation
Quick reporting and accurate information help speed up the process.
OPTIONAL ADD-ONS IN HOME INSURANCE
Many insurers offer optional extras to enhance coverage, such as:
- Accidental damage cover
- Portable contents cover (items outside the home)
- Emergency repairs
- Legal liability protection
- High-value item coverage
These add-ons provide more comprehensive protection depending on individual needs.
